Check Your Thermostat Settings
Sometimes, the simplest solution is the right one. If your furnace is blowing cold air, start by checking your thermostat settings. Ensure it is switched to “HEAT” instead of “COOL” or “FAN ON.” The fan-only mode circulates air without warming it, which can make it seem like your system is not functioning properly.
Next, examine the temperature setting. If it is too low, your furnace may not activate as expected. Try increasing the temperature by a few degrees and wait to see if warm air starts flowing. Additionally, weak or dead thermostat batteries can prevent the thermostat from communicating with the furnace. Replacing them is a quick and easy fix that might restore proper function.
If these adjustments do not solve the problem, your thermostat may not be sending the right signals to your heating system. Wiring issues, incorrect programming, or sensor malfunctions could be causing the furnace to run improperly. In such cases, a professional technician can diagnose and resolve the issue.
By ensuring your thermostat is set correctly, you can avoid unnecessary discomfort and service calls. If your furnace still is not producing warm air after these checks, further inspection may be required to identify the underlying cause.
Inspect Your Furnace Air Filter
A clogged air filter can restrict airflow, causing your furnace to overheat and shut down the burners as a safety precaution. When this happens, the blower may continue running, but only cold air will come from the vents. To avoid this issue, follow these steps:
- Check for Clogs – A dirty filter blocks airflow, making it harder for your furnace to heat your home efficiently. If your filter looks dusty or clogged, it is time to replace it.
- Follow Replacement Guidelines – In Mesa and Globe, AZ, dust and allergens accumulate quickly. Experts recommend replacing your air filter every 1 to 3 months to ensure consistent airflow.
- Improve System Performance – A clean filter helps your furnace run more efficiently, reducing strain on the system, improving indoor air quality, and lowering energy costs.
- Prevent Overheating and Shutdowns – When airflow is restricted, your furnace can overheat and shut down its burners. This safety feature prevents damage but can leave you with cold air blowing through the vents.
- Watch for Recurring Issues – If your furnace still blows cold air after replacing the filter, a deeper issue may exist, such as a malfunctioning blower motor or heat exchanger.

Look for Pilot Light or Ignition Issues
A furnace relies on a properly functioning ignition system to produce heat. If your unit is blowing cold air, the problem may be with the pilot light or electronic ignition. Whether you have an older or modern system, ignition failure can disrupt heating. Here’s what to check.
-
Inspect the Pilot Light
If you own an older furnace, it likely has a standing pilot light. Check if the flame is out, and if so, relight it according to the manufacturer’s instructions. A weak or flickering flame may indicate a gas flow issue.
-
Identify Common Causes A pilot light
can go out due to drafts, dirt buildup, or a faulty thermocouple. If it won’t stay lit, the thermocouple may need replacement to ensure the gas valve shuts off properly when needed.
-
Examine an Electronic Ignition System
Most modern furnaces use an electronic igniter instead of a pilot light. If the unit repeatedly attempts to start but fails to produce heat, the igniter or flame sensor may be dirty, damaged, or misaligned.
-
Reset the Furnace
Minor ignition issues can sometimes be fixed with a reset. Turn off the furnace for one minute, then restart it. If the ignition engages, the issue may have been temporary.
-
Call for Professional Repairs
When your furnace still refuses to ignite, the problem could be a faulty gas valve, ignition module, or flame sensor. These components require expert diagnosis and replacement.

Check for a Tripped Circuit Breaker
Furnace systems rely on electricity to power essential components like the blower motor, ignition system, and control board. If a circuit breaker trips, the unit may attempt to run but won’t generate heat. Follow these steps to determine if an electrical issue is preventing proper operation.
- Locate the Electrical Panel – Your home’s circuit breaker panel is usually found in the basement, garage, or utility room. Identify the breaker labeled for the furnace.
- Check for a Tripped Breaker – If the breaker is in the “OFF” or halfway position, it has likely tripped. A sudden power surge, overloaded circuit, or faulty component could be the cause.
- Reset the Breaker – To restore power, switch the breaker completely to the “OFF” position, wait 10 seconds, then turn it back to “ON.” If your furnace starts running again, monitor it closely.
- Watch for Repeated Tripping – If the breaker trips again, do not keep resetting it. Frequent tripping can indicate a serious issue such as a failing blower motor, shorted wiring, or an overheating component.
- Call an Expert for Electrical Repairs – Electrical malfunctions in a furnace can pose safety hazards, including fire risks. If the breaker continues to trip, contact a professional to inspect the wiring, connections, and system components.

Examine the Gas Supply
Furnace systems that rely on natural gas require a steady fuel supply to generate heat. If gas flow is interrupted, the burners won’t ignite, and your system will only blow cold air. Follow these steps to determine if a gas supply issue is preventing proper operation.
-
Check Other Gas Appliances
Test your stove, water heater, or other gas-powered appliances. If none are working, there may be a home-wide gas supply issue, and you should contact your utility provider for assistance.
-
Inspect the Gas Shutoff Valve
Locate the gas shutoff valve near the furnace. If it is in the “OFF” position, carefully turn it back “ON” and wait a few minutes before attempting to restart the system. If you smell gas, shut it off immediately and seek professional help.
-
Look for Blocked or Damaged Gas Lines
Gas lines can develop obstructions due to debris, moisture buildup, or corrosion. If your furnace attempts to ignite but fails repeatedly, there may be a restriction preventing proper combustion.
-
Reset the System
If gas flow appears normal but the furnace won’t light, turn the system off for one minute, then restart it. Some models require multiple ignition attempts before resuming normal function.
-
Contact a Professional for Gas Repairs
If troubleshooting does not restore heat, the gas valve, pressure regulator, or ignition system may be faulty. Gas-related repairs should always be handled by a licensed technician for safety.

Investigate the Ductwork for Leaks
Leaky or disconnected ducts can allow warm air to escape before reaching your living spaces. This can make it seem like your furnace is blowing cold air when, in reality, heat is leaking into your attic, basement, or walls. Checking for duct leaks can help restore proper airflow and improve heating efficiency.
-
Inspect visible ductwork
Examine any exposed ducts in your attic, basement, or crawl spaces. Look for gaps, holes, or loose connections where heated air may be escaping. If there are visible openings, sealing them may improve your system’s efficiency.
-
Check for airflow leaks
Run your furnace and place your hand near duct joints and seams. If you feel warm air escaping, there is likely a leak reducing your heating efficiency. Even small leaks can force your system to work harder, increasing energy costs.
-
Listen for unusual noises
Whistling or hissing sounds near ductwork often indicate air escaping through small openings. These leaks may seem minor, but they contribute to uneven heating and wasted energy.
-
Seal minor leaks
If you find small openings, use HVAC-approved foil tape to seal them. Standard duct tape should be avoided, as it deteriorates over time and won’t provide a lasting fix.
-
Call a professional if needed
If leaks persist or if most of your ductwork is hidden behind walls, professional inspection may be necessary. An HVAC technician can locate hidden leaks and seal them properly to restore full efficiency.

Inspect the Heat Exchanger for Damage
The heat exchanger is the heart of your furnace, responsible for safely transferring heat while keeping harmful gases contained. When this critical component cracks or malfunctions, your system may blow cold air, struggle to maintain warmth, or even release dangerous carbon monoxide. A damaged heat exchanger is not just a heating issue—it is a serious safety concern.
-
Check for Cold Air and Inconsistent Heating
If your furnace is running but the air feels lukewarm or cold, the heat exchanger might be compromised. When cracks form, the exchanger can no longer effectively transfer heat.
-
Notice Any Strange Odors
A damaged heat exchanger may produce a metallic, chemical, or burning smell when the furnace is in use. If you detect an unusual odor, turn off your system and seek professional assistance.
-
Look for Moisture or Soot
Excess condensation on windows near vents or black soot around the furnace could signal combustion problems, often linked to a deteriorating heat exchanger.
-
Pay Attention to Health Symptoms
A faulty heat exchanger can leak carbon monoxide, an odorless gas that can cause dizziness, headaches, or nausea. If your carbon monoxide detector goes off, evacuate immediately and call emergency services.
-
Schedule an Inspection at the First Sign of Trouble
Heat exchanger damage worsens over time, potentially leading to system failure or health risks. Only a certified technician can assess the severity of the issue and determine if repairs or a replacement are necessary.
A cracked heat exchanger is one of the most dangerous furnace problems, requiring immediate attention. If you suspect damage, do not delay—professional inspection is essential for your safety and peace of mind.
Consider the Furnace’s Age
The efficiency of a furnace declines over time, leading to uneven heating, higher energy bills, and frequent breakdowns. An older system may struggle to maintain warmth, cycling more often and working harder to produce the same level of comfort. If your home experiences cold spots or takes longer to heat, the system may be reaching the end of its lifespan.
A well-maintained furnace can last for years, but frequent repairs may indicate it is time for an upgrade. Constant service calls add up, making replacement a more cost-effective solution. Newer models are designed for improved efficiency, reducing energy consumption and lowering heating costs.
An outdated furnace may also lack modern features that enhance comfort and performance. Advanced systems operate more quietly, distribute heat evenly, and integrate with smart thermostats for better temperature control. If your energy bills have been rising despite regular maintenance, an inefficient system could be the cause.
Instead of waiting for complete failure, planning for a replacement ensures reliable heating when you need it most. If your furnace is showing signs of decline, upgrading to a newer model can provide better efficiency, improved comfort, and long-term savings.
Schedule Professional Furnace Maintenance
Routine maintenance is essential for keeping a furnace operating efficiently and preventing unexpected breakdowns. Over time, dust buildup, worn components, and airflow restrictions can reduce performance, causing higher energy bills and potential system failures. Regular inspections help identify small issues before they turn into costly repairs.
A professional furnace tune-up includes thorough cleaning, safety checks, and performance testing. Technicians inspect for gas leaks, clean burners, test ignition systems, and verify airflow to ensure proper function. Catching minor problems early extends the system’s lifespan and reduces the risk of emergency breakdowns.
Skipping maintenance can lead to inefficiency, frequent repairs, and even safety hazards. A neglected furnace may struggle to maintain temperature, work harder to heat your home and increase energy consumption. Investing in annual service ensures consistent performance and reliable warmth throughout the colder months.

FAQS
-
Why is my furnace blowing cold air?
A furnace may blow cold air due to thermostat settings, a dirty air filter, ignition failure, or a tripped circuit breaker. Check that the thermostat is set to “HEAT” and the fan is on “AUTO.” If the issue persists, professional service may be required.
-
How do I reset my furnace?
Turn off the power switch or circuit breaker for one minute, then turn it back on. If your furnace has a reset button, press it once. If the system still blows cold air, an ignition or gas supply issue may need professional attention.
-
Can a clogged air filter cause cold air issues?
Yes, a dirty filter can block airflow, causing the furnace to overheat and shut down the burners. Replace the filter every one to three months to prevent airflow restrictions.
-
What if my furnace shuts off frequently?
Frequent shutdowns may indicate overheating, a dirty flame sensor, or a faulty thermostat. If replacing the filter does not help, schedule an inspection.
